AutoRaise showcase three events

AutoRaise events in partnership with The Vella Group and Blackpool & The Fylde College hailed a massive success.

Three AutoRaise showcase events held to raise awareness of AutoRaise and apprenticeship opportunities in the industry have created eight potential new apprentices for The Vella Group.

The events, held at The Vella Groups Workington, Preston and Chester sites saw local young people come together with local repairers and industry suppliers to create a unique event.

The Vella Group, who are partnering with Blackpool & The Fylde College to initially create 10 new apprentice positions for the AutoRaise multi-skilled apprenticeship standard, had the pleasure of being able to involve its teams and families in the events following its recent re-branding exercise.

Helen Driscoll, HR manager at The Vella Group said, ‘The show case events were a resounding success. The support from AutoRaise and B&FC, along with the industry partners, meant that the events went even better than we hoped. Despite us holding them the week after the local schools finished, and with quite short notice, AutoRaise and B&FC worked really hard to ensure that where was plenty of positive interest on the nights’.

Blackpool & The Fylde College recently committed to deliver the AutoRaise multi-skilled apprenticeship standard and The Vella Group will fill the first ever group of multi-skilled apprentices at the college.

Claire Jameson, director of business development at B&FC for Business, said, ‘I’m delighted with the number of repairers and potential apprentices who engaged with these events and can only envisage even more interest in the future.’
